Why Weave Exists

At Weave, our mission is to evolve how therapeutic knowledge is captured, transformed, and communicated throughout drug development. We do this by equipping human experts with AI instruments to enable drugs to be brought to patients as rapidly, safely, and inexpensively as possible.

The Weave Platform streamlines regulatory workflows from start to finish by intelligently, creatively, and effectively infusing every step with AI. Together with our customers, Weave is designing and building the AI workbench for the entire therapeutic lifecycle.

The Role & Your Mission

We are seeking a highly motivated Sales Development Representative to join our commercial team reporting to the VP of Sales. In this role, you will focus on generating leads and new business opportunities within the biotech, pharmaceutical, clinical research organization (CRO) and consulting space offering a transformational solution for regulatory content generation and document management. Your work will help drive the adoption of our AI-powered platform, enabling clients to streamline regulatory processes, ensure compliance, and accelerate time to market. The day-to-day efforts will also drive brand awareness, lead to key partnerships and collaborations, and support the company’s hyper growth in a fast-paced evolving market. This role will be located in our San Francisco HQ office.

What You'll Own
  • Lead Generation & Prospecting: Research, identify and target potential clients within the biotech, pharmaceutical, CRO and consulting space, with a focus on executives, leaders in regulatory strategy and operations, medical writers and drivers of technology innovation across the industry.
  • Outbound Outreach: Partner with Weave’s Marketing team to execute outbound campaigns via phone, email, and social to engage with prospects and drive interest and demand for the Weave offering.
  • Qualification: Run initial qualification calls with potential clients, guiding them through the first stages of the evaluation process.
  • Strategic Collaboration: Partner closely with Account Executives to identify, source, and research net new pipeline within strategic accounts and specific lines of business/personas.
  • Product Knowledge: Work closely with our Product team to maintain a working knowledge of our capabilities, features, benefits, and near-term roadmap priorities. 
  • CRM Utilization: Accurately track and update lead interactions, qualification status, and pipeline information in CRM tools (HubSpot, Tableau, Salesforce, etc.).
  • Event Participation: Drive prospect and customer attendance for Weave podcasts, webinars, user groups, and speaking forums. 
  • Metrics & Reporting: Meet or exceed monthly and quarterly targets for outbound outreach and meetings booked.
What You’ll Bring
  • Experience: 1+ years of experience in business development or sales with an emphasis on SaaS or software sales, ideally within life sciences, pharmaceutical, biotechnology, or clinical research industries. 
  • Communication Skills: Strong ver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to engage and influence senior-level decision-makers in complex industries.
  • Sales Acumen: Proven ability to engage prospects and create compelling opportunities to move prospects through the sales funnel.
  • Tech-Savvy: Comfortable working with CRM systems, email automation tools, and other sales enablement platforms.
  • Self-Starter: Highly motivated, organized, and able to work independently to meet or exceed sales targets.
  • Interest in AI & Automation: Passion for innovative technologies, particularly AI and automation, and how they can transform business processes.
  • Bachelor's degree in Life Sciences, Business or a related field is required. 
  • Experience with SaaS or document management solutions is required.
  • Previous exposure to the biotech, pharmaceutical, or clinical research industry is highly desirable.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
